Thursday, 5 March 2009
  • A rebroadcast of the now-infamous Joaquin Phoenix appearance on Letterman, parodied by Ben Stiller at this year’s Oscars. Invited onto the show to promote his new movie, Two Lovers, which co-stars Oscar-winner Gwyneth Paltrow, he failed to do so. The interview, which generated over two and a half million hits on the Late Show website and has generated a lot of web-speculation that it was an act. It was described by www.rollingstone.com as possibly “the most paranoid, drugged-out interview ever.” A bearded, incoherent Phoenix mumbles his way through Letterman’s questions, at one point taking his chewing gum from his mouth and sticking it to his hosts desk.
